Indulge in these ultra-fudgy brownies topped with a creamy Baileys Irish Cream buttercream frosting. Perfect for St. Patrick's Day or any occasion that calls for rich chocolate decadence with a boozy twist.
Grease a 9x9-inch baking pan with cooking spray and set aside.
Sift together the flour and salt; set aside.
Place the butter and chopped chocolate in a saucepan and melt over low heat, stirring frequently, until melted and smooth.
Remove from heat and stir the sugar into the chocolate mixture; let cool for 3 minutes.
Pour the chocolate mixture into your mixer's bowl and beat in the eggs, one at a time.
Mix in the Baileys Irish Cream until well combined.
Stir in the flour mixture with a wooden spoon just until combined.
Spread the batter evenly into the prepared pan.
Bake for 30 to 35 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
Cool in pan on wire rack completely before frosting.
Buttercream Frosting
Place all frosting ingredients (softened butter, powdered sugar, and Baileys) in a large bowl and blend with an electric mixer until smooth and creamy.
Spread the frosting evenly on top of the cooled brownies.
Slice into squares and serve. For clean cuts, chill for 10 minutes before slicing.
Notes
For best results, use high-quality chocolate and real Baileys Irish Cream. Store brownies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days or refrigerate for up to 5 days. These are perfect for gifting!
